Description:
The 'base' library exposes the 'hGetEcho' and 'hSetEcho' functions
for querying
and setting echo status, but unfortunately, neither function works with MinTTY
consoles on Windows. This is a serious issue, since 'hGetEcho' and
'hSetEcho'
are often used to disable input echoing when a program prompts for a password,
so many programs will reveal your password as you type it on MinTTY!
